ROTAX MANDATORY SERVICE BULLETINS

The bulletins cover checking of the crankcase for cracks (especially in the area of cylinder No 1 upper side, between cylinder 1 and 3 upper side and cylinder 4 lower side.(classified by Rotax as Mandatory). They have been advised to the AUF through the Rotax automatic advice system.
For the certificated versions of the 912 and 914, the bulletins are on the same piece of paper, but have different bulletin numbers for each type in the heading as in the links above. The UL versions are covered similarly on a separate one page sheet advising serial number applicability, but this sheet refers back to the certificated version of the bulletin for action details.
